From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:
iceboat \iceboat\ n.
1. A ship with a reinforced bow to break up ice and keep
channels open for navigation; an icebreaker.
Syn: icebreaker.
[WordNet 1.5]
2. a sailing craft with runners and a cross-shaped frame;
suitable for traveling over ice; it is usually propelled
by a sail, and sometimes by an engine-powered propeller.
Syn: ice yacht.
[WordNet 1.5]
